This is straight from the settings guide:

Add .bc! Extension to Incomplete File:

When this option is enabled, BitComet will add “.bc!” to the end of the file extension. Instead of

MyDownload.rar

the filename will be changed to

MyDownload.rar.bc!

in the directory listing.

BitComet will change the extension back to normal when the download completes. This is useful because you can tell from a glance at the directory, which files are incomplete. It will also save you the mistake of trying to use an incomplete file.
